所属分类:web前端开发
Vue报错:无法正确使用filters中的过滤器,怎样解决?
引言:
在Vue中,过滤器(filters)是一个常用的功能,可以用来对数据进行格式化或者过滤。然而,在使用过程中,有时候我们可能会遇到无法正确使用过滤器的问题。本文将介绍一些常见的原因和解决方法。
一、原因分析:
二、解决方法:
Vue.filter('myFilter', function(value) { // 过滤器的具体逻辑处理 return value; });
<p>{{ message | myFilter('param1', 'param2') }}</p>
Vue.filter('myFilter', function(value) { // 过滤器的具体逻辑处理 return value.toUpperCase(); //将value转为大写 });
Vue.filter('myFilter', function(value) { // 过滤器的具体逻辑处理 return value; });
结论:
在使用Vue过滤器时,如果遇到报错的情况,首先需要检查过滤器的注册、传递参数、函数定义以及作用域等因素。根据具体情况进行相应的调试和修改,以确保过滤器能够正常使用。
通过本文的介绍,希望读者能够更加清楚地了解Vue过滤器的使用,以及解决可能遇到的问题。只有熟练掌握Vue过滤器的使用和调试方法,才能更好地开发出高质量的Vue应用程序。